Web20 mei 2011 · Cut a 10" x 12" blank from a piece of 3/4 inch thick MDF or cabinet grade plywood such as birch or oak (I made the push stick in the photo from a scrap of oak plywood) . Do not use dimensional lumber or low-grade plywood, which can twist and … Web8 jan. 2024 · The idea behind the push stick is to push the wood towards, through and past the blade, while keeping your hands at a safe distance. You actually need two. One to push then one to hold the wood down as it passes through the blade. However you only need to really notch the one that pushes the wood. IF you use this type. Web11 jun. 2024 · 1. Push stick – the term generally used to refer to a tool used to “push” and designed with a long handle and a notch. 2. Push blocks – uses a thick block of wood attached to a handle and a hook that holds onto a workpiece. 3. Push pads – a flat pad with two handles attached to it.
